AN avid gamer has gone from his bedroom to the bright lights of Miami after ditching his day job to complete professional.

Gary Porter, 32, has loved gaming since he got his first PlayStation One more than 20 years ago.

But 18 months ago he began streaming online on Twitch and TikTok and his popularity grew massively.

Since then, his channel Big Daddy Gmann has received more than 2.1 million likes, with almost 75,000 followers on TikTok alone.

Now Gary has ditched his day job as a barber to go pro and recently flew to Miami for the TikTok global awards as one of the top live streamers.

Gary said: “It is a bit surreal, to be honest.

“But I had a vision from the start. I got a lot of stick for pursuing it but now I am where I am, and it feels great.

“It has come with a lot of sacrifice. I have missed a lot of birthdays, holidays, family events and quality time with people.

“But it is a job, so you have to live and breathe it. I wouldn’t change it as every day is exciting. I go to bed thinking about the next move or next content.”

Gary, who mainly streams warzone, says he is the only gamer to now win the weekly rankings on TikTok and is the highest ranked gamer in the UK.

This achievement saw him invited to the TikTok global awards in Miami, where he was flown out for four days.

Gary has also set up his owner agency to help other live streamers grown.

He added: “It was for a select few streamers from every country around the world.

“I had four days in Miami, and it was my first-time flying first class, which was an experience.

“It has taken four years of consistency, daily content, and live entertainment to get to streaming full-time.

“I have now also started my own gaming agency to help other live streamers grow and pursue their dream to be a full-time live streamer.”
